MSCK REPAIR PRIVILEGES
適用於: Databricks SQL Databricks Runtime
從與 對象相關聯的所有使用者中移除所有許可權。
您可以使用這個語句清除在 Databricks SQL 或 Databricks Runtime 外部的 Hive 中繼存放區卸除對象之後留下的剩餘存取控制。
語法
MSCK REPAIR object PRIVILEGES
object
{ [ SCHEMA | DATABASE ] schema_name |
FUNCTION function_name |
TABLE table_name
VIEW view_name |
ANONYMOUS FUNCTION |
ANY FILE }
參數
-
將移除權限的架構命名為 。
-
將許可權從中移除的函式命名。
-
將移除權限的資料表命名為 。
-
將許可權從中移除的檢視命名。
ANY FILE
ANY FILE
撤銷所有用戶的許可權。ANONYMOUS 函式
ANONYMOUS FUNCTION
撤銷所有用戶的許可權。
範例
> MSCK REPAIR SCHEMA gone_from_hive PRIVILEGES;
> MSCK REPAIR ANONYMOUS FUNCTION PRIVILEGES;
> MSCK REPAIR TABLE default.dropped PRIVILEGES;